Graphics Board Sales Increase in Q3 as Does Nvidia's Market Share

The latest report from Jon Peddie Research estimates that shipments of add-in graphics boards (vs integrated chipsets) increased nearly 11 percent in the third quarter of 2006 over the second quarter and nearly 8 percent over the 2005 third quarter. However, the total value continued to decline and was 12 percent less that the 2005 third quarter, reflecting a significant 20 percent decrease in price per board year over year.

Add-in graphics boards continued to be used predominantly in the performance sector (75%). The mainstream sector stood at 13 percent, workstations at 5 percent, enthusiasts at 4 percent and the value sector at 3 percent.

Nvidia at 59 percent continued to gain market share from ATI/AMD at 40 percent. All others were only 0.6 percent. [Bill Fox]
